Back to Chios, Alone
The wedding tour complete and Sean heading home to hold down the fort, phase two of my adventure kicked into high gear. The Gulecs hosted a tasty brunch at their house — featuring lots of yummy fried morsels — and we bid adieu to those going on “The Blue Voyage,” a boat cruise Onur and Chrissy arranged for their friends that were making it out to the Turkish wedding. I sadly decided not to go. While I knew I’d be missing one of the best memory-making experiences ever, I had the opportunity to stay somewhere equally beautiful, free of charge. Now that my income is negative, I have to pick and choose a bit more carefully.
After lounging and dozing by the pool with my London-based friends, Taj and Ragi, I boarded a ferry back to Chios, where I would spend the night. Still sick and rather tired, I told my biker friends I wasn’t up for hanging and spent a rather uneventful night in my hotel room uploading my pictures and watching “Open Water” with Greek subtitles.
